The Original Series: Cast and Characters

21 Jump Street first aired on April 16, 1987, and quickly gained a following due to its unique premise of police officers going undercover in high schools. The show was known for tackling issues such as drug abuse, gang violence, and teenage pregnancy, all while maintaining a sense of humor.

Main Cast Members

  • Johnny Depp as Officer Tom Hanson
  • Peter DeLuise as Officer Doug Penhall
  • Dustin Nguyen as Officer Harry Ioki
  • Holly Robinson Peete as Officer Judy Hoffs
  • Michael Bendetti as Officer Dennis Booker

Each of these actors brought their unique talents to the show, allowing audiences to connect with their characters on a personal level.

Movie Adaptations: Cast and Characters

The success of the original series led to the production of two movie adaptations: 21 Jump Street (2012) and 22 Jump Street (2014). These films offered a comedic take on the original premise while introducing a new cast that resonated with a younger audience.

Main Cast Members of the Movies

  • Channing Tatum as Jenko
  • Jonah Hill as Schmidt
  • Ice Cube as Captain Dickson
  • Ellie Kemper as Ms. Griggs
  • Dave Franco as Eric

The chemistry between Tatum and Hill was a significant factor in the films' success, bringing a fresh and humorous perspective to the franchise.

Biographies of Key Cast Members

Understanding the backgrounds of the main cast members provides insight into their performances and contributions to the franchise. Below is a table highlighting key information about selected cast members.

NameRoleBirthdateNotable Works
Johnny DeppOfficer Tom HansonJune 9, 1963Pirates of the Caribbean, Edward Scissorhands
Channing TatumJenkoApril 26, 1980Magic Mike, Step Up
Jonah HillSchmidtDecember 20, 1983Superbad, Moneyball
Holly Robinson PeeteOfficer Judy HoffsSeptember 18, 1964Hangin' with Mr. Cooper, For Your Love
Ice CubeCaptain DicksonJune 15, 1969Friday, Barbershop

Cultural Impact of 21 Jump Street

The cultural impact of 21 Jump Street, both in its original series and the film adaptations, cannot be understated. The show was groundbreaking in its approach to serious issues faced by teenagers, making it a pioneer in the genre of teen dramas.

Some notable impacts include:

  • Addressing societal issues: The series opened discussions on topics that were often taboo, such as drug use and bullying.
  • Influencing future shows: The format and themes of 21 Jump Street have inspired numerous other series focusing on youth culture.
  • Revival of interest: The successful films reignited interest in the original series, leading to new generations discovering the show.
